This document discusses blue phosphor materials made from cerium-doped strontium barium niobate (SBN) for applications in holographic data storage, lighting, and displays. SBN has a tetragonal tungsten bronze structure and can be prepared using a sol-gel method for better control of structure and homogeneity. Characterization of cerium-doped SBN using XRD and IR spectroscopy confirmed that the SBN structure was maintained while optical properties changed, making it a potential blue emitter material.
